TOPIC: white powder on stalk

white powder on stalk 13 years 7 months ago #4350

I was gathering seeds from my plants this weekend (good year so far). However about 10% of these plants had a white powdery substance on the stalk leading to the seeds (and on some seeds). Should I worry or is this normal?

Re:white powder on stalk 13 years 7 months ago #4352

I have had the same thing. I have noticed this over the years and it is no big deal in my opinion. If it gets really thick and builds up on the seed stems I will sometimes wipe it off with my fingers. Not sure, but I think it might be powdery mildew.

Re:white powder on stalk 13 years 7 months ago #4386

Joe we get it also and it's a small sucking bug that extrudes white fluffy stuff out of it's back as defence.
There tiny little buggers, no big deal unless you are invaded by them.
